Dapr Agents v1.0 Brings Production Reliability to AI Agent Frameworks on Kubernetes

Kubernetes agents are production reality in 2026 as KubeCon Europe launched Agentics Day. 82% of container users run Kubernetes in production. 66% use it for GenAI inference workloads. 41% of AI developers are cloud-native. Agents automate incident response, IaC review, and FinOps optimization. The CNCF AI Conformance Program standardizes GPU scheduling across distributions. DRA reached GA in K8s 1.34. MCP standardizes agent communication. However, 47% cite cultural challenges and 56% face platform engineering skill shortages.

70% of CEOs Will Pursue Revenue Growth Without Headcount Expansion Using Agentic AI

Agentic AI productivity enables revenue growth without proportional hiring. 90% of leaders expect AI-driven revenue. 42% of CFOs plan AI headcount reductions. McKinsey operates 25,000 agents alongside 40,000 employees heading toward parity. Early pilots show 70-80% cost per transaction reductions. However, only 1% of layoffs stem from actual AI gains and only 39% report enterprise EBIT impact. High performers redesign workflows rather than automating tasks and set growth goals alongside efficiency targets.

NIST CSF 2.0 and AI RMF: The Compliance Convergence CISOs Must Master

NIST CSF 2.0 converges with the AI Risk Management Framework through the new Cyber AI Profile released December 2025. The Govern function elevates cybersecurity to board-level strategic accountability. The profile applies CSF structure across three focus areas: Secure AI systems, Defend with AI, and Thwart AI-enabled attacks. CISOs who anchor governance in CSF 2.0 build a single compliance backbone mapping to NIS2, EU AI Act, ISO 42001, and sector mandates — eliminating framework sprawl. 106 subcategories, six functions, continuous compliance replacing static audits.

Five Governments Will Nationalize or Restrict Critical Telecom Infrastructure

Telecom regulation is shifting from market oversight to state control as five governments nationalize or restrict critical infrastructure in 2026. The Salt Typhoon cyberespionage campaign breached 600+ organizations across 80 countries, exposing telecom vulnerability to nation-state attackers undetected for years. Australia enforces SOCI Act oversight. Italy restructures its network for 22 billion euros. The US bans adversary vendor subsea cable ownership. Quantum security spending exceeds 5% of IT budgets. Cloud-telecom regulatory convergence creates overlapping compliance obligations.

CNCF’s Dapr Agents v1.0 Delivers Production Reliability for AI Agent Frameworks

Dapr agents v1.0 reached GA at KubeCon Europe 2026 as the first CNCF-backed cloud-native agent runtime. Built on Dapr’s 34K+ star runtime with NVIDIA collaboration, it delivers durable execution surviving crashes, scale-to-zero with 3ms activation, secure multi-agent coordination, and 30+ pluggable state stores. ZEISS Vision Care and EU logistics companies run it in production. Unlike frameworks focused on LLM logic, Dapr agents solve the infrastructure problem: failure recovery, state persistence, and cost-efficient scaling for business-critical agent deployments on Kubernetes.

By 2028, 75% of Enterprise Engineers Will Use AI Code Assistants Daily

The AI code assistant has become the fastest-adopted developer tool in enterprise history. Gartner predicts 90% of engineers will use them by 2028, up from 14% in early 2024. GitHub Copilot reaches 20M users with 4.7M paid subscribers. Developers complete tasks 55% faster and 46% of code is AI-generated. However, 46% do not trust outputs and AI PRs show 1.7x more issues. The $7.37B market demands security gates, quality measurement, and role evolution toward orchestration.
